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BS2
The NM_005065.6(SEL1L):āc.1846C>Gā(p.Leu616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000867 in 1,613,896 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(ā ).

SEL1L (HGNC:10717): (SEL1L adaptor subunit of SYVN1 ubiquitin ligase) The protein encoded by this gene is part of a protein complex required for the retrotranslocation or dislocation of misfolded proteins from the endoplasmic reticulum lumen to the cytosol, where they are degraded by the proteasome in a ubiquitin-dependent manner.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2011]

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Jul 19, 2022 | The c.1846C>G (p.L616V) alteration is located in exon 1 (coding exon 1) of the SEL1L gene. This alteration results from a C to G substitution at nucleotide position 1846, causing the leucine (L) at amino acid position 616 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
